iOS马甲包开发如何顺利通过审核




iOS马甲包开发的秘密:如何顺利通过审核
在如今的移动互联网时代,iOS开发者面临着前所未有的机遇和挑战。其中,“马甲包”作为一种特定的应用开发方式,近年来越来越受到开发者的欢迎,它不仅能帮助开发团队在不影响用户体验的情况下快速迭代产品,还能在不同的市场中进行产品的精准定位。但如何有效地开发和审核通过iOS马甲包呢?本文将深入探讨iOS马甲包的开发技术及其审核机制,为开发者提供实用的建议。
什么是iOS马甲包?
首先,了解什么是iOS马甲包至关重要。马甲包是指开发者以一种产品的基础上,进行小幅度修改和重包装后,重新发布的应用程序。这些修改可能包括更改应用的名称、图标、描述等基本信息,以此来测试不同市场和用户群体的反应,或者是为了规避苹果应用商店的某些限制。从本质上讲,马甲包是一种“兄弟应用”,它们分享同一代码库,具备相似的功能,但在某些方面有所区别。
马甲包的开发技术
1. 提炼核心功能
在马甲包的开发过程中,首先需要明确应用的核心功能。一般来说,核心功能是指用户使用应用的主要原因。为了确保整个开发过程的顺利进行,开发者需要从市场调研中确认这些功能的必要性,并在设计和开发中着重考虑其用户体验。
2. 设计个性化界面
尽管马甲包是基于同一代码基础,但在用户界面(UI)和用户体验(UX)方面的细微差别可以极大地影响用户的使用感受。因此,开发者需要根据目标用户的特征,定制界面和视觉设计。可以通过更改颜色、字体、图标以及布局等元素,来塑造应用独特的品牌形象,提升用户的粘性。
3. 动态内容更新
为了提高马甲包在应用商店中的收益及用户活跃度,开发者可以引入动态内容的更新机制。例如,通过推送通知、定期推出新活动或更新应用内容,引导用户频繁使用应用。此举不仅能提升用户体验,也能增加应用的使用时长,进而提高在 App Store 中的排名。
4. SEO优化
同样重要的是,SEO优化。在提交应用之前,开发者需要仔细研究应用的关键词设置与描述。合适的关键词能够帮助应用在搜索结果中获得更好的排名。可以利用关键词工具进行相关研究,确保所用关键词与应用的实际功能及用户需求相符,从而吸引到更多目标用户。
如何顺利通过App Store审核
在iOS马甲包的审核过程中,有许多因素决定了应用是否能够顺利通过审核。以下是一些成功经验和技巧,帮助开发者有效应对。
1. 遵循苹果的审核指南
App Store审核指南是开发者需要牢牢把握的一个环节。开发者在开发和提交应用之前,务必通读并理解苹果的审核政策。确保应用遵循各项条款,包括但不限于用户隐私保护、内容限制以及适当的用户界面设计等,避免因违反政策导致审核失败。
2. 详细的应用描述
在提交审核的时候,应用描述的准确性和详细程度也会影响审核的结果。开发者需要提供清晰的应用功能介绍、使用说明以及与用户的交互内容。同时,在描述中可以适当加入相关的参考链接,使审查人员能够简洁明了的了解应用的功能和创新之处。
3. 提供有效的测试账号
若应用需要用户登录,开发者应该在提交审核时提供测试账户信息,便于审核人员全面评估应用的功能。通过提供有效的登录接口与测试账户,能够显著提升审核的效率,不至于因为审核人员在使用中遇到困扰从而导致审核延迟或失败。
4. 适时更新应用版本
持续的应用维护和版本更新是建立良好应用信誉的基础。开发者需关注用户反馈和使用数据,及时对应用进行优化和升级,以适应市场变化和用户需求。不论是bug修复还是功能强化,定期更新能够使应用在审核中获得更好的评价。
5. 预留客服支持
用户在使用应用过程中难免会遇到各种问题,开发者需提前准备详细的客服支持信息,包括常见问题解答和联系反馈方式。在应用的描述中,适当引导用户寻求帮助,使他们在使用中感到更安心,有助于提升用户的体验。
结论
iOS马甲包开发是一项极具挑战和创造性的工作。通过深入理解马甲包的概念、开发技术以及审核机制,开发者能够更好地应对市场变化及用户需求。在这个快速发展的移动技术时代,掌握这些技能将是你成功的关键。希望各位开发者在实际操作中能够灵活应用以上方法,顺利通过App Store的审核,取得更大的成功。